I've purchased 8 of the brownings, 3 different models. Had issues with 4 of them and like swat, they were due to the battery tray contacts. You may want to check the contacts to see if they need to be cleaned. If you have one that will work and one that is having the issue, you may want to see if swapping the trays causes the problem to follow. Also, if you have access to an external 12v power source, that could rule out the camera internals and confirm the contact issue. Browning will replace the trays, so you may want to check with them if it points to that.
But to answer your original question, yes. A couple of seasons ago I loaded two of them up with fresh lithiums and confirmed that they were working when I left. Came back a week later and both had no power. Removed the trays, bumped them a couple of times and they started working again. Came back a few days later and both had stopped working again. It was very frustrating and I decided to move them into less important locations. I had Browning replace the trays and they are back working again, but I still only relegate them to less important areas.
